Hanoi, Nov. 21 -- Vietnam Railways Corporation (VNR) on November 21 announced continued suspension of multiple passenger services departing from Hanoi, Da Nang and Ho Chi Minh City, as widespread flooding in the south-central region persists.

According to the corporation, trains SE6/SE5 and SE8/SE7 running between HCM City and Hanoi, along with SE22/SE21 operating between HCM City and Da Nang, have been cancelled on November 21. Rail services had already been heavily disrupted in recent days as prolonged downpours inundated many sections of the North-South route.
